Pence Slated To Make Israel Visit Ahead Of Biden Inauguration

By Staff Reporter
Posted on 12/10/20 | News Source: i24

United States Vice President Mike Pence and National Security Adviser Robert O’Brien are expected to arrive in Israel within the coming weeks, according to multiple sources and cited in The Jerusalem Post.

O’Brien is likely to arrive first, with reports that he will be in Israel next week, while Pence is likely to arrive early in the new year, before President-elect Joe Biden’s inauguration on January 20.

These high profile visitors follow Secretary of State Mike Pompeo’s whistlestop tour of several nations in the Middle East, including Israel. His arrival was significant as it heralded a shift in certain long-standing US policy positions – most notably allowing Israeli products made in the West Bank to be labeled “Made in Israel.”
